The Orange County Sanitation District is seeking a C-7 licensed contractor for a subcontract to install and maintain low-voltage systems at its sites in Fountain Valley. The scope of work includes the installation and upkeep of telecommunications, CCTV, and landscape lighting systems, provided they operate at or below 91 volts. Notably, the installation of fire alarm systems is explicitly excluded from this contract. Interested parties must submit their responses by July 30, 2026. This opportunity falls under NAICS code 238220 and is managed by the agency in California. Further details and application processes are available through the BidAmerica portal.
